## Deployment

ProseGate (our docs linter) ships as a single container and redeploys automatically on merge to main. If you're on call and lint jobs start timing out, just roll back to the previous tag — state is stateless, nothing to migrate. Rule packs are baked in at build time, so no hotfixing those. The runtime configuration it boots with is below.

settings of yafog-kagep:
NOVVAN_PIN=8841
NOVVAN_TENANT=pelwyn
NOVVAN_METRICS_HOST=metrics.novvan.orvexforge.example
NOVVAN_SEAL=seal_30060f3e
NOVVAN_STANDBY_TEAM=wenox

// Heads-up for the sync: this constant caps chunk size for the
// Bramblediff large-file viewer. Above it, we stream hunks lazily
// instead of materializing the whole diff, which is why the 2GB
// log files stopped freezing tabs. Don't raise it without profiling
// first — memory climbs fast past this point. Benchmarks were run
// against the build noted below.

pipeline stamp: htk21_0e1a1ddcdb5bfd88d6dd6

// Fixture for the Glimmerton tile cache tests.
// Heads up: these fixtures simulate a cold cache, so the first
// render call always misses and hits the upstream Rasterfox
// service. Don't "fix" that — it's the whole point.
// Eviction is LRU with a 512-tile cap; see cache_config.yml.
// The mock upstream expects requests authenticated with the
// bearer token on the next line.

login token, bagug-kafop: eyJhbGciOiJIUzI1NiIsInR5cCI6IkpXVCJ9.eyJzdWIiOiIcMLov2In0.Z5RLDIfp